基于JS实现新闻列表无缝向上滚动实例代码_javascript技巧
程序员文章站
2022-05-23 13:52:41
...
当新闻较多,并且空前有限的时候,使用滚动是一个不错的选择,本章节就通过代码实例介绍一下如何实现此效果。
代码实例如下:
文字列表无缝向上滚动代码
以上代码实现了新闻列表滚动效果,下面介绍一下实现过程:
一.实现原理:
大致原理如下,demo元素中有两个子元素demo1和demo2,并且将demo1中的内容存入demo2中,之所以这样做,是为了当向上滚动的时候,demo2能够接在demo1的后面,否则将不是无缝滚动,而是有缝滚动了,当demo1的内容完全被遮挡之后,也就是demo1完全滚动上去的时候,demo2会恰好位于demo1开始滚动的位置,然后再重新设置demo的scrollTop值,让滚动就重新来过,这样就实现了无缝滚动效果。
基于JS实现新闻列表无缝向上滚动实例代码就给大家介绍到这里,希望大家根据自己的实际需求应用此段代码。
推荐阅读
-
利用JavaScript实现新闻滚动效果(实例代码)_javascript技巧
-
Javascript实现滚动图片新闻的实例代码_javascript技巧
-
基于JS实现新闻列表无缝向上滚动实例代码_javascript技巧
-
基于JS实现新闻列表无缝向上滚动实例代码_javascript技巧
-
js实现单行文本向上滚动效果实例代码_javascript技巧
-
js实现Select列表内容自动滚动效果代码_javascript技巧
-
JS小功能(offsetLeft实现图片滚动效果)实例代码_javascript技巧
-
JavaScript中实现无缝滚动、分享到侧边栏实例代码_javascript技巧
-
js实现Select列表内容自动滚动效果代码_javascript技巧
-
JS小功能(offsetLeft实现图片滚动效果)实例代码_javascript技巧